You always start an OpenSearch Ingestion pipeline beginning with a pipeline that's already in the stopped state. The pipeline keeps its configuration settings such as capacity limits, network settings, and log publishing options.
Restarting a pipeline usually takes several minutes.
To start a pipeline
-
Sign in to the Amazon OpenSearch Service console at https://console.aws.amazon.com/aos/home
. -
In the navigation pane, choose Pipelines, and then choose a pipeline. You can perform the start operation from this page, or navigate to the details page for the pipeline that you want to start.
-
For Actions, choose Start pipeline.
To start a pipeline by using the AWS CLI, call the start-pipeline command with the following parameters:
-
--pipeline-name
– the name of the pipeline.
aws osis start-pipeline --pipeline-name
my-pipeline
To start an OpenSearch Ingestion pipeline using the OpenSearch Ingestion API, call the StartPipeline operation with the following parameter:
-
PipelineName
– the name of the pipeline.
